The Allaaba of Ethiopia

The Allaaba of Ethiopia, numbering approximately 379,000 people, are Engaged yet Unreached. They are an ethnolinguistic community of Ethiopia. They are an Indigenous people, in the Sidama people cluster of the Horn of Africa Peoples affinity bloc. Their primary religion is Islam - Sunni. They primarily speak Alaba-K’abeena.
